Circumstances Leading to Death (Normally from War Diary)           

On 9th July 1916 the battalion up to Pommiers Redoubt in prepartion for an attack on Mametz Wood the following day. At 4.45am on the 10th July 114th Brigade launched the attack an that lasted for over 2 days and ended in the early hours of the 12th July. Arnold died at some stage during the period 10th to 12th July. The CWGC always uses the last known date men could have been killed.
